Address

1EDHBrqD7o2cYPgFiB5oPZFQENgvNzRM8Y
Confirmed tx count
2
Confirmed received
1 output (34.20516873 BTC)
Confirmed spent
1 output (34.20516873 BTC)
Confirmed unspent
No outputs